How they compare
Brazil currently reports 13.36 million against 11.78 million in Egypt, a difference of 1.58 million.
That makes Brazil's figure about 1.1 times Egypt's.
Across all 74 years both countries report, Brazil has been ahead every year.
Brazil ranks 10th and Egypt ranks 11th of 236 countries.
Brazil has averaged higher in every one of the 8 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| Egypt |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 10.88 million | 4.18 million | 6.71 million | Brazil |
| 1960s | 13.98 million | 5.04 million | 8.94 million | Brazil |
| 1970s | 15.57 million | 6.20 million | 9.37 million | Brazil |
| 1980s | 18.08 million | 8.08 million | 10.00 million | Brazil |
| 1990s | 17.41 million | 9.02 million | 8.39 million | Brazil |
| 2000s | 16.15 million | 9.99 million | 6.16 million | Brazil |
| 2010s | 14.53 million | 12.50 million | 2.03 million | Brazil |
| 2020s | 13.73 million | 12.18 million | 1.55 million |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
